G7 Leaders Address Global AI Governance, Access, and Dominance Amidst US Curbs

Why It Matters

The G7 summit represents a crucial moment in defining the future trajectory of global AI, with major economies striving to balance innovation, national security, and ethical considerations, while navigating complex geopolitical dynamics around technological leadership and access.

Key Intelligence

  • G7 leaders and top AI executives convened to discuss global AI governance, safety, and the establishment of international standards for artificial intelligence.
  • Discussions focused on creating a 'trusted partners' framework to ensure allied access to cutting-edge US AI models, in light of existing US export restrictions and concerns about 'AI protectionism'.
  • European nations expressed apprehension regarding the perceived American dominance in AI and emphasized the need for harmonized regulations and strategies to foster domestic AI development.
  • Key AI industry leaders, including CEOs from OpenAI and Anthropic, participated in discussions to address AI risks and advocate for a US-led coalition on global AI rules.
  • The summit also explored practical measures such as the release of 'Minimum Elements for AI Software Bills of Materials' by CISA and G7 partners to enhance transparency and security in AI supply chains.
